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Coventry to Boroughbridge is to bus and line 843 bus which costs £15 - £25 and takes 6h 1m.
The fastest way to get from Coventry to Boroughbridge is to drive which takes 2h 15m and costs £30 - £50.
No, there is no direct bus from Coventry to Boroughbridge. However, there are services departing from Coventry University and arriving at St James Square via Asda, Leeds City Bus Station and Rail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 1m.
The distance between Coventry and Boroughbridge is 163 miles. The road distance is 136.5 miles.
The best way to get from Coventry to Boroughbridge without a car is to train and line 84 bus which takes 4h 2m and costs £65 - £110.
It takes approximately 4h 2m to get from Coventry to Boroughbridge, including transfers.
Coventry to Boroughbridge b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from Asda station.
Coventry to Boroughbridge bus services, operated by FlixBus, arrive at Leeds City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Coventry to Boroughbridge is 136 miles. It takes approximately 2h 15m to drive from Coventry to Boroughbridge.
